Emotions do not make a military action constitutional.

Trumps statement was an appeal to emotion and not an appeal to a constitutional provision that allowed him to unilaterally send missiles directed at a Sovereign Nation that posed no threat to the security or vital interests of the United States.

If Assad used poison gas on his own citizens, that is terrible. It is not, however, a valid excuse for the United States to launch a Missile attack.

If we launched missile attacks at every dictator who abused his citizens, we be out of missiles before we got to 1/10th of them.
